public static class TrackHelper.EventBuilder
extends java.lang.Object
| Modifier and Type | Method and Description |
|---|---|
TrackMe |
build()
May throw an
IllegalArgumentException if the TrackMe was build with incorrect arguments. |
TrackHelper.EventBuilder |
name(java.lang.String name)
Defines a label associated with the event.
|
TrackHelper.EventBuilder |
path(java.lang.String path)
The path under which this event occurred.
|
boolean |
safelyWith(MatomoApplication matomoApplication) |
boolean |
safelyWith(Tracker tracker)
build() can throw an exception on illegal arguments. |
TrackHelper.EventBuilder |
value(java.lang.Float value)
Defines a numeric value associated with the event.
|
void |
with(MatomoApplication matomoApplication) |
void |
with(Tracker tracker) |
public TrackHelper.EventBuilder path(java.lang.String path)
public TrackHelper.EventBuilder name(java.lang.String name)
public TrackHelper.EventBuilder value(java.lang.Float value)
public TrackMe build()
IllegalArgumentException if the TrackMe was build with incorrect arguments.public void with(MatomoApplication matomoApplication)
public void with(Tracker tracker)
public boolean safelyWith(MatomoApplication matomoApplication)